Blagojevich Calls For Assault Weapons Ban
Jan. 17, 2006




Governor Rod Blagojevich is renewing his call to end gun violence.

He and other state leaders spoke in Chicago today to call for a ban on assault weapons.

Its been more than a year since the federal ban on assault weapons was allowed to expire, and now Illinois law makers are working to renew the ban here.

The proposed bill would ban the manufacture, possession, and delivery of semi-automatic assault weapons, assault weapon attachments, and the .50 caliber assault rifle.

Governor Blagojevich plans to ask congress to renew the ban in order to protect the people of Illinois.

"This isn't just about protecting our communities and our neighborhoods this isn't just about common sense gun laws that exercise and use common sense, its also about protecting our police officers and law enforcement across our state."

Blagojevich said that while the federal ban was in effect, there was a 66 percent reduction in the number of assault weapons that were confiscated at crime scenes.

But last year, in the city of Chicago alone 400 assault weapons were found after the ban expired. He hopes the bill will once again make that number decrease.

Blagojevich will talk about the assault weapons ban and other topics Wednesday at his State of the State Address.

Here is Daley's side of it, these guys amaze me.


CHICAGO (AP) - Gov. Rod Blagojevich and Chicago Mayor Richard Daley renewed calls Tuesday for a statewide ban on assault weapons.

The two Chicago Democrats, who have been pressing for the ban since a federal measure banning assault weapons expired more than a year ago, appeared together at a rally in Chicago.

"Every sane person would agree that machine guns and grenades should be illegal," Daley said in his prepared remarks. "Their only purpose is to kill large numbers of people. The same is true of military-style assault weapons."

President Clinton signed a federal ban on assault weapons in 1994, but the ban expired in September 2004 when Congress decided not to renew it.

Since then, Daley and Blagojevich have pushed for a state law that would prohibit the manufacture, possession and delivery of semiautomatic weapons, assault weapon attachments and the .50-caliber assault rifle.

Assault weapons are currently illegal in Chicago. Illinois lawmakers narrowly rejected a proposed ban on assault weapons and .50-caliber rifles last May amid intense lobbying by both sides in the debate.

The National Rifle Association argued that the proposed statewide ban was too broad and would ban weapons used by hunters, target-shooters and collectors as well.

Daley said earlier this month that he would continue pushing for stricter gun laws, even though several of his proposals have failed to pass the Illinois General Assembly in recent years.

Illinois HB2414 is the bill that would ban the sale and possession of certain semi automatic and .50 caliber rifles. The original bill also calls for felony provisions for mere possession of all over 10 round magazines. In the last legislative session, an amended watered down version of this bill failed passage by a couple votes due to the fact that it contained technical legal language, now removed, that could have effected some shotguns used by skeet and clay pigeon shooters. By watered down I mean that the sale of semi autos and .50 caliber rifles would be discontinued, but the firearms in question owned prior to the effective date would be "grandfathered in" for original owners and transfers to close family members.  

In my estimation, there's a fair chance the amended version of this bill may pass by this spring. I rather doubt that any gun law will be promulgated in Illinois that contains provisions that would subject gun owners who continued to merely possess "assault rifles" to a 5 year prison sentence for each accountable offense. At least not yet!

In Illinois, much like in any political sphere, if you are at Stage 1 and you want to get to Stage 5, ask for 10, then compromise down the middle. Bear in mind that Illinois is a pretty left leaning state, particularly Cook County and the surrounding collar counties. Most citizens of Illinois favor the FOI card licensing system and the restrictive semi auto ban. Most gun owners do too, unfortunately. While the Illinois State Rifle Association primarily appeals to our influential hunting and clay shooter crowd, they have never spoken out against our outrageous licensing scheme to the best of my knowledge.

Due to the Illinois FOI card fiasco and our state's constitutional RTK&BA provision "subject to police powers," owning a gun and ammunition is a privilege in Illinois, not a right.
